Lambda phage protein Nu 1 contains the conserved DNA binding fold of repressors.

Abstract:

:Analysis of 64 lambda phage proteins revealed the presence of four strong variants of the conserved DNA binding fold of repressors. Three of them have been known from previous studies but the Nu 1 gene product is a new member of the family of proteins that may bind strongly to DNA in the repressor-like fashion. It is peculiar that the motif occurs in the very N terminus of Nu 1 just between two possible starts of its gene.
